Transaction 62b8475ed5cb9f7be5b5866c74d2ac28610058c42dfaf15a9e4afd373c978cf2
1 Input
2 Outputs
- 62b8475ed5cb9f7be5b5866c74d2ac28610058c42dfaf15a9e4afd373c978cf2:0
- 62b8475ed5cb9f7be5b5866c74d2ac28610058c42dfaf15a9e4afd373c978cf2:1
value 4166481
address 3QkFHx17eS11CTo5Z5VcYDJhGH5G8cB1oy
value 13133978
address 1KmrQEcuAx1U4GjddcmoTPh4kfR25enyDF